Sausages In Wine

INGREDIENTS

1/2 lb Kielbasa
1/2 lb Italian sweet sausage
1/2 lb Italian hot sausage
1/2 lb Bockwurst, ground veal
sausage
5 Green onions, minced
1/2 c Dry white wine
1/2 t TABASCO pepper sauce
1 T Finely chopped fresh parsley
or l teaspoon dried
optional

INSTRUCTIONS

With sharp knife, cut sausages into l/2-inch pieces. In deep
skillet,over medium-high heat, cook Italian sausage pieces 3-5  minutes
or until lightly browned. Drain. Add remaining sausage pieces  and
green onions and cook 5 additional minutes. Reduce heat to low,  add
wine, Tabasco pepper sauce and parsley, if desired. Simmer 8 to  l0
minutes, stirring every 2 to 3 minutes to be sure all sausage  pieces
are flavored with wine. Remove from heat and pour into chafing  dish.
Sausages may be frozen for future use. Serve with toothpicks.  Makes 4
cups.  Busted by Karen Sonnessa <>  Recipe by: Tabasco www.tabasco.com
